There are two primary types of wind turbines used in implementation of wind energy systems: horizontal-axis wind turbines (HAWTs) and vertical-axis wind turbines (VAWTs). . A wind turbine is a device that converts the kinetic energy of wind into electrical energy. Wind turbines come in several sizes, with small-scale models used for providing electricity to rural homes or cabins and community -scale models used for providing electricity to a small number of homes within a. . A wind turbine turns wind energy into electricity using the aerodynamic force from the rotor blades, which work like an airplane wing or helicopter rotor blade. [PDF Version]

What is energy storage as a service?

o known as Energy Storage as a Service (ESaaS). This model enables third-party providers to own, operate and maintain energy storage systems, offering them through subscription or pay-per-use structures.
